Grape Of The Art - Armagnac Marquestau 1998 - 25YO - 51.7% - 70cl
A new 100% Baco Armagnac unearthed by The Grape Of The Art from an as yet undiscovered estate in Hontanx, Landes. The style is resolutely traditional: rich, woody and complex. The nose is reminiscent of plums, undergrowth and a vinous touch reminiscent of a Pauillac. On the palate, there's tobacco, orange marmalade and coffee, with a fine evolution after dilution.
Serge Valentin (Whiskyfun): ‘The effect of a few drops of water here is maximal and spectacular.’
90 points (only 87 without water, so absolutely must be tested with it!)

Nestled in the heart of Bas-Armagnac, Maison Marquestau has been perpetuating the art of armagnac making since the XIXᵉ century through a sober and rigorous approach. On the estate's sandy soils, traditional grape varieties give rise to eaux-de-vie distilled in continuous stills, then aged slowly in Gascon oak barrels. The Marquestau style is distinguished by its balance: a straightforward attack, with notes of dried fruit, light tobacco and mild spices, supported by a supple, elegant structure. The house may remain discreet, but it will win over discerning wine-lovers with the depth of its vintages, which are often aged for long periods. Each bottle bears witness to precise expertise, handed down with respect for natural cycles, far removed from the effects of fashion. Marquestau embodies a certain idea of armagnac: distinguished, timeless, rooted in its terroir.
“Grape of the Art” (GotA) is a project that showcases exceptional Armagnacs and Cognacs, bottled in single casks and without reduction, to satisfy rum and whisky lovers. The concept was born of a group of enthusiasts in Stuttgart who, after discovering the quality and diversity of Armagnacs, decided to devote themselves to this French eau-de-vie. Their aim is to reveal the hidden treasures of small producers by selecting rare, unaltered casks.
